Ethernet type parameters
Ethernet Type parameters can be configured when Ethernet Type is selected as the
Frame Type.
Object Description
EtherType Filter Specify the Ethernet type filter for this ACE.
Any: No EtherType filter is specified (EtherType filter status is "don't-care”).
Specific: If you want to filter a specific EtherType filter with this ACE, you
can enter a specific EtherType value. A field for entering a EtherType value
appears.
Ethernet Type Value When Specific is selected for the EtherType filter, you can enter a specific
EtherType value.
The allowed range is 0x600 to 0xFFFF but excluding 0x800(IPv4),
0x806(ARP) and 0x86DD(IPv6). A frame that hits this ACE matches this
EtherType value.
